鍾惠恩 | Chung Wai Ian
鍾惠恩的作品探索存在於日常生活的衝突和不尋常的狀態,以改造、重組、修補物件呈現事物的另一個可能性。
2009年,她於香港浸會大學視覺藝術院畢業,作品「水泥乒乓球枱」於藝術推廣辦事處公共藝術計劃 2015 獲選;曾參與項目包括藝術推廣辦事處「邂逅! 山川人」(2018)、啟德「土炮遊樂場」(2016)、C &G 藝術空間「
錦田、釜山藝術交流計劃——後桃花園記」(2015)、香港奧沙畫廊「這麼近那麼遠——香港和英國之間的某處」(2013)、ArtOxygen印度孟買藝術家駐留計劃
「[en]counters 2011」(2013)。現為 1a 空間籌委會成員,及本地藝術設計工作室MUDWORK 創辦人之一。
Chung Wai Ian’s works explores the conflicts and unusual states exists in daliy life, and present another possibility through transformation, reconstruction and repairation. She received her Bachelor of Visual Arts from Academy of Visual Arts, HKBU in 2009. Her work ‘Cement Ping Pong Table’ won the Public Art Scheme in 2016 which curated by Art Promotion Office. She has participated in projects including Art Promotion Office ‘Hi!Hill’ (2018), Kai Tak ‘Play Depot’(2017), C&G Artpartment ‘Art
exchange project between Kam Tin and Busan
- In Search Of Peachland’ (2015), Osage Gallery ‘Both Sides Now -
Somewhere between Hong Kong and the UK’ (2014), ArtOxygen ‘Mumbai Artist-in-Resident - [en]counters’ (2013). She is one of the artisitc panels of 1a Space, and one of the founders of local art group ‘MUDWORK’.
